Now I finally have something exciting to report, today I was woken up just before my alarm at about 6.15 by some excited shouts of 'T8, T8!!!' from the living room. Hong Kong has a rating of typhoon warnings which goes T1, T3 and T8, and if a T8 is declared school gets closed! Obviously we heard about Typhoon Nesat in the phillipines but they hardly ever make their way over here, there wasn't a T8 warning all last year for the CNET's. Last night there was a T1 warning, and when I went to sleep it was really windy, but I never even thought about it getting worse. Getting used to the whole 'living for the weekend' thing is strange. I never realised how quickly time can fly between Friday night and Sunday, and i'm thanking my lucky stars I actually quite enjoy my job (apart from lesson plans, and schemes of work, and action plans. Basically paperwork in general. I'm not good at keeping things in files!). But this week the sunday blues are a lot easier to handle because Tuesday is the mid-Autumn festival in Hong Kong, which means a day off work! Hong Kong has more public holidays than anywhere else in the world, and it is also an odd school policy that whenever there's a school outing, everyone has the day off after.
